About the Role
As a member of our team, your primary role will be to provide support for the Program Management team with Manufacturing, Production, and Customer Management support within the Automotive Division.
What You Will Do
Support DV build activities, working with Pilot Plant, Mechanical and Hardware Engineers
Perform testing and validation activities
Support Program Managers with day-to-day program activities as needed
Perform software and hardware verification.
Assist customer or developers to debug issues.
Maintain/update defects database with a defect tracking tool.
Support customer demo and test drive event.
Organize/maintain the change management tracker.
Organize/maintain local product inventory and support customer deliveries.
Assist in the creation or enhancement of metric tracking required by the Program Management Organization.
